How do you keep track of where you are in your cross stitch? This is Shannon, and I like to use a highlighter, but as you can see from some of my recent cross stitch projects, I'm a little inconsistent with my use of said highlighter. 😆

I'm new to obsessive cross stitching, and I really do find it to be super helpful to be able to highlight sections after I finish them. But then sometimes I will get on a roll, and not mark what I've done. For me, the hardest part about counted cross stitch is the actual counting, so if I can do anything to help myself not have to count much, I am in. 😬

It’s ! It’s Day ONE of the Stitch-a-Long, friends! Are you starting your cross stitch today? How/where do you begin?

I like to start in the middle; I do the whole fold the fabric in half both ways and try to find the exact center of the work, then start there. I also like to start with the words, and then fill in any florals or other patterns afterward. Finishing the words feels like a huge accomplishment to me, every single time.
